Turkish shipyard Bilgin announced sale 47.5-metre superyacht former known as Nerissa, in collaboration with Thompson Westwood & White. The yacht now christened Starburst III was asking € 19,600,000 at the time of sale.

The new owner has ordered minor customisations of both exterior and interior concepts of the yacht, first debuted at Monaco Yacht Show 2017. The changes are due to be completed within a month.
As to the exterior, the owner expressed a wish to change the original white colour used by exterior designer Unique Yacht Design, to a darker grey tone. Meanwhile, Starburst III’ solid exterior features large windows and amenities, such as sky lounge and relaxation zone with seating and Jacuzzi.

Starburst III can accommodate up to 10 guests on-board within four larger cabins instead of more traditional five-cabin layout. The yacht also features with a spacious master suite with a hull balcony.

The vessel’s interior design originally developed by H2 Yacht Design is trademarked with a blend of various woods into the main combination of marble, copper and leather materials used in décor. Her main saloon will be easily be transformed into an open saloon with large sliding doors. The yacht will now undergo minor changes in colour palette and will be equipped with additional furniture.
